Temporal and Spatial Distribution Characteristics of Human Comfort Degree: In Yangtze River Regions Under Climate Change

Abstract: To quantitatively evaluate the temporal and spatial variation characteristics of human comfort degree in Yangtze River regions, based on daily relative humidity and average temperature data from 434 conventional weather observation stations from 1961 to 2011, using human comfort index model, we systematically analyzed the seasonal variation and spatial distribution of human comfort degree in these regions and conducted a corresponding risk zoning. The results showed that: (1) except summer, human comfort degree value for the whole year and other seasons showed significant decrease in zonal distribution from south to north; (2) comfortable day and uncomfortable day gradually decreased from south to north, while very uncomfortable day showed a significant reverse trend; (3) the value of human comfort degree of the whole year and the four seasons rose with the rate of 0.302/10 a, 0.162/10 a, 0.211/10 a, 0.355/10 a and 0.484/10 a, respectively; the human comfort degree of the whole year as well as spring, autumn and winter gradually increased, but decreased significantly in summer; (4) human comfort value of the whole year and spring, autumn and winter had obvious mutation characteristics, the mutated point occurred in the late 1980s, showing an upward trend in the latter part, to a certain degree, climate change increased the human comfort degree of the whole year and spring, autumn and winter, reduced human comfort degree in summer. The results provide a basis for habitat environmental decision-making, comprehensive development and utilization of tourism climate resources and guarantee of tourism meteorological service in Yangtze River regions.
